    Types of Treadmills Available in the UK

    1. Handbook Treadmills

    • Description: These treadmills do not have an electric motor. Rather, they need users to create power manually.
    • Pros: They are generally more affordable, compact, and do not require electricity.
    • Cons: They may not be as smooth or versatile as electric treadmills.

    2. Motorized Treadmills

    • Description: These treadmills feature an electric motor that drives the belt, enabling smoother operation.
    • Pros: They use higher speed choices and adjustable programming for workouts.
    • Cons: They can be more pricey and might use up more space.

    3. Folding Treadmills

    • Description: Ideal for those with minimal space, these treadmills can be quickly folded and kept away.
    • Pros: Space-saving and portable, often including wheels for easy motion.
    • Cons: They may be less resilient than non-folding models.

    4. Commercial Treadmills

    • Description: Designed for health clubs and physical fitness centers, these treadmills normally have more effective motors and higher weight capabilities.
    • Pros: Very long lasting and frequently included sophisticated features.
    • Cons: Generally, a higher price point and can be bulky.

    5. Desk Treadmills

    • Description: Equipped with a desk, these treadmills allow users to stroll while working.
    • Pros: Encourages exercise throughout the day, perfect for desk jobs.
    • Cons: They might have lower speed limits and minimized workout intensity.

    Secret Features to Consider When Buying a Treadmill

    When selecting a treadmill, buyers must consider numerous important features:

    • Motor Power: Measured in horsepower (HP), a stronger motor supports higher speeds and incline settings.
    • Belt Size: A larger belt accommodates a larger stride, catering to taller individuals or those who run.
    • Incline Options: Adjustable slopes duplicate hill running, increasing exercise strength.
    • Integrated Programs: Pre-set exercises and adjustable programs can boost physical fitness regimens.
    • Cushioning System: Look for treadmills with advanced cushioning to minimize effect on joints.
    • User Weight Capacity: Ensure the treadmill Uk sale can support the user’s weight; this is particularly essential for industrial models.
    • Foldability: For those with minimal space, check if the treadmill can be quickly folded and saved.

    Tips for Maintaining Your Treadmill

    To guarantee your treadmill stays in optimum condition, consider these maintenance pointers:

    • Regular Cleaning: Wipe down the surface and remove dust and particles to prevent damage.
    • Lubrication: Periodically oil the belt to reduce friction and wear.
    • Look for Wear: Examine the belt and deck for indications of wear, replacing parts when needed.
    • Secure Cables: Ensure wires and cables are correctly protected to prevent tripping threats.
    • Calibration: Familiarize yourself with the producer’s calibration instructions to preserve accuracy in range and speed readings.

    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

    1. How much area do I need for a treadmill?

    A devoted space of around 7-8 feet in length and 3 feet in width is typically suggested to accommodate the treadmill and enable for safe use.

    2. Are treadmills ideal for beginners?

    Yes, treadmills are ideal for all fitness levels. Users can start at a sluggish rate and gradually increase strength and speed as their physical fitness improves.

    3. How often should I use a treadmill for weight loss?

    For efficient weight-loss, a constant routine of at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ity workout weekly is advised, which can be attained through routine treadmill workouts.

    4. Can I view TV while utilizing a treadmill?

    Yes! Many treadmills are designed with holders for devices, enabling users to watch TV or use tablets while exercising.

    5. What is the average lifespan of a treadmill?

    With correct maintenance, the average life expectancy of a treadmill ranges from 7 to 12 years. Business models may last longer due to their robust building and construction.
